One of the best-loved American contemporary poets, Adrienne Rich has been writing feminist verse for more than five decades.... An example of her better known poems, "Living in Sin"was published in a book called The Diamond Cutters in 1955, and is a compelling feminist portrait of a couple's fading love, when faced with the harsh realities of day-to-day existence.

Upon spotting his intriguing interest in Couture as well as his aesthetic potential, she permitted Cristobal to design a copy of the Haute Couture she was wearing at that moment.... When he returned at age sixteen, he opened his first fashion design workshop in San Sebastian where he started designing the Parisian Style for Spanish women (Walker, Museum, and Fashion 65-66).... He travelled to Madrid in 1920 where he opened his second fashion design workshop but had to leave the country when the Civil War broke out....
